First, you have to understand that you're talking about two different things. It can get a bit confusing, and both deserve some consideration to use them effectively.

The first is Failsafe-Return to Home (RTH). If that is enabled in Naza Assistant ("Failsafe - Go Home and Landing"), then the Phantom will first ascend to 66ft height (IF it is under 66ft when failsafe is activated) and then fly back to home before landing. So if you activate failsafe on the ground or while hovering 5ft in the air, it'll take off and ascend first.

The second is home lock, which is a flight mode. It's best to read up on it in the manual; it doesn't do anything by itself, you have to fly it around with the sticks. Plus, it only works when you are more than 10m away from home point. If you are any closer, it switches into course lock mode (do read up on that as well, since you are bound to hit it using home lock). Pulling back on the right stick is the correct way to bring your Phantom back in home lock mode, but again it will only do so if you're farther than 10m away from home point.
 
is there a way to reprogram it to fly higher than 60ft on RTH? I am working around some spruce trees that are about 100ft high.
 
Photogd said:
is there a way to reprogram it to fly higher than 60ft on RTH? I am working around some spruce trees that are about 100ft high.

Get home lock.

Take off, and vertically ascend to 50ft height.

Reset a custom homepoint with the s2 switch.

It should now ascend to ~110ft above takeoff point and before flying back and slowly descending to the ground on RTH.
